Transaction 19b2ef23c258dc3bf8bffd61233495a60feae425077e593ce3f4e8fde9e5bbea
1 Input
1 Output
-
19b2ef23c258dc3bf8bffd61233495a60feae425077e593ce3f4e8fde9e5bbea:0
- value
- 491697
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ddd3ffbce79366d5589721c62e176d2d91a849c2 OP_EQUAL
- address
- 3MuwDtJfG1n89NSXmxzces7b4FPu1jt9qg